Understanding Biometric Data
Biometric data encompasses a variety of unique identifiers, including fingerprints, facial recognition data, iris scans, voice patterns, and even gait analysis. This data is used across numerous applications—from unlocking smartphones and accessing secure buildings to enabling advanced healthcare services and verifying identities for financial transactions.
While the benefits of biometric data are clear, its misuse poses significant risks. Biometric data is non-transferable and cannot be changed like a password. Once compromised, it can be exploited for fraudulent activities, making its protection paramount.
The Importance of Biometric Privacy
Protecting your biometric data is crucial because it's inherently linked to your identity. Unlike traditional passwords or PINs, which can be reset, stolen biometric data can lead to long-lasting consequences. It’s essential to understand the implications and take proactive steps to secure this unique information.
Tips for Safeguarding Your Biometric Data
1. Limit Biometric Data Sharing
One of the most straightforward ways to protect your biometric data is to limit where and how it's shared. Avoid using the same biometric identifier across multiple platforms. If a service asks for your fingerprint or facial scan, consider whether it’s absolutely necessary. When in doubt, opt for traditional authentication methods.
2. Use Advanced Device Security Features
Modern smartphones and computers come equipped with advanced security features designed to protect biometric data. Utilize these features to their fullest extent. For instance, enable device encryption, which ensures that even if a device is compromised, your biometric data remains secure.
3. Regularly Update Software and Applications
Cybersecurity threats evolve rapidly, and so must your defenses. Regularly updating your device's operating system and the applications you use helps to patch vulnerabilities that could be exploited to access your biometric data.
4. Be Cautious with Public Wi-Fi
Public Wi-Fi networks are often less secure and more susceptible to hacking attempts. Avoid accessing sensitive information or using biometric authentication over public Wi-Fi. If you must use public networks, employ a Virtual Private Network (VPN) to encrypt your connection.
5. Review App Permissions
Applications that request access to your biometric data often do so to enhance user experience. However, not all apps need such access. Review and restrict permissions for apps that don't genuinely require access to your biometric data.
6. Secure Your Physical Devices
Biometric data isn't just stored digitally; it’s also associated with physical devices. Ensure that your smartphones, tablets, and other biometric-enabled devices are physically secure. Use device locks, screen timeouts, and consider adding an extra layer of physical security like a PIN or pattern lock.
7. Educate Yourself on Biometric Privacy Laws
Familiarize yourself with the biometric privacy laws in your country or region. Understanding your rights and the regulations that govern the use and protection of your biometric data can empower you to make informed decisions and hold entities accountable.

The Enigma of Black Swan Events
In the unpredictable realm of cryptocurrency, "Black Swan" events are those rare, high-impact occurrences that lie beyond the realm of regular expectations. Named after Nassim Nicholas Taleb's concept, these events are characterized by their unpredictability, massive impact, and the retrospective clarity they bring once they happen. As we look towards 2026, the crypto market stands on the cusp of potential upheavals and innovations, each capable of shaking the foundations of the digital currency world.

Technological Breakthroughs
Innovation is the lifeblood of the crypto world, and by 2026, we could witness technological breakthroughs that no one foresaw. Consider advancements in quantum computing, which could potentially disrupt current encryption methods used in blockchain technology. Quantum computers might break existing cryptographic protocols, leading to a rapid transition to quantum-resistant algorithms. This shift could either create a short-term market turmoil or catalyze an era of unprecedented security and trust in digital currencies.
Another potential Black Swan could be the emergence of a new consensus mechanism that outperforms both Proof of Work and Proof of Stake models. Imagine a new algorithm that combines the best aspects of both, offering superior energy efficiency and security. Such an innovation could become the new standard almost overnight, disrupting the status quo and reshaping the competitive landscape of blockchain technology.
